J.C. Leyendecker: An American Master Rediscovered
One of the most prolific and successful artists of the Golden Age of American Illustration, J. C. Leyendecker captivated audiences throughout the first half of the 20th century. Leyendecker is best known for his creation of the archetype of the fashionable American male with his advertisements for Arrow Collar. These images sold to an eager public the idea of a glamorous lifestyle, the bedrock upon which modern advertising was built.…

About The Author
Laurence S. Cutler
Laurence S. Cutler is an architect, author, and the chairman and cofounder of the National Museum of American Illustration.
Judy Goffman Cutler is an art dealer, author, owner of the American Illustrators Gallery in New York, and a cofounder of the National Museum of American Illustration. The Cutlers live in Newport, Rhode Island.
